Last year (2008) was a really good year for me in the industry overall, i really feel that we (myself and my long suffering brother) achieved alot with the relaunch of Kronik Music and we made some really good new alliances within the scene. I also parted ways with all of the company's that i felt were not representing me properly as an artist which was a bold move, but also the right move for me at this time in my career. Last year the achievements were more than i hoped for and i feel that we laid some solid foundations to build on, featuring on the biggest compilations again was a good look even more so when my new track B.a.s.s.l.i.n.e. feat MC Neat was included on the PURE BASSLINE cd! look out for that this year it will be getting a full release through Nip N Tuck Recordings.

Some of the other things that made last year such a good one for me were the trip to Russia, that was an amazing expierience to represent UKG in a place like that, a very humbling booking that made me come over all patriotic! ha ha! Also the quote in DJ international magazine "one of the main inspirations for bassline" was extremely flattering! Then we come to the now legendary Kronik Music events in portugal which were totally off the hook and inspired me to relaunch the IT'S A LONDON THING events as a regular thing, last year there were 4 IALT events and each and every one of them was totally electrical! NEW YEARS EVE was alot! sorry if you were one of the 150 who didnt get in but we will be doing a payback party soon to make up for it in a bigger venue!
